Crime rate in Morton, PA

The 2020 crime rate in Morton, PA is 100 (City-Data.com crime index), which is 2.5 times smaller than the U.S. average. It was higher than in 49.9% U.S. cities. The 2020 Morton crime rate fell by 41% compared to 2019. In the last 5 years Morton has seen rise of violent crime and decline of property crime.

The City-Data.com crime index weighs serious crimes and violent crimes more heavily. Higher means more crime, U.S. average is 246.1. It adjusts for the number of visitors and daily workers commuting into cities.




According to our research of Pennsylvania and other state lists, there were 7 registered sex offenders living in Morton, Pennsylvania as of May 17, 2024.
The ratio of all residents to sex offenders in Morton is 384 to 1.
